Effective management and planning of truck fleets in open-pit mines is crucial because transportation costs constitute a significant portion of operational expenses and directly affect overall operational efficiency. Choices and strategies concerning fleet allocation are influenced by the selected objective function and the constraints embedded within mathematical models, which can result in considerable economic and operational outcomes for mining activities. In this research, to examine in greater depth the economic impacts of selecting the objective function in modeling, two integer programming models are created for truck fleet allocation. The first model intends to reduce overall operational costs such as fuel, maintenance, labor, component wear, and other related expenses, whereas the second model concentrates exclusively on reducing fuel consumption expenses as the primary economic factor. To assess the suggested method and analyze potential differences, both models were developed and evaluated using actual and reliable operational data from the Sungun copper mine. The numerical findings indicate that both models convey almost identical quantities of high-grade and low-grade ore to the processing plant, with only minor variations that do not significantly affect ore delivery. However, the greatest difference is noted in waste transportation; the volume of waste moved in the second model is roughly 42 percent greater than that in the first model. This notable difference suggests that concentrating only on fuel expenses may inadvertently raise the total volume of waste transported, causing shifts away from production and financial objectives. In comparison, the comprehensive cost model offers a more equitable allocation and aligns better with the mine’s operational goals by presenting a broader, more integrated, and more balanced perspective on cost distribution and operational efficiency.
